About agriculture in Beechboro

Beechboro is situated in the north-eastern outskirts of Perth, Western Australia, acting as a gateway to the fertile Swan Valley. The surrounding landscape transitions from suburban residential areas into expansive rural plains and rolling vineyards. This proximity to the Swan River provides a unique microclimate that has historically supported diverse agricultural endeavors amidst the growing urban sprawl.

The agriculture in the vicinity is dominated by viticulture, with numerous established vineyards and boutique wineries. Beyond grapes, the area supports market gardening, including the production of seasonal vegetables and citrus fruits. Some smaller landholdings also engage in equine activities and hobby farming, benefiting from the rich alluvial soils deposited by the nearby river systems.

For agronomists and seasonal workers, the region offers opportunities particularly during the grape harvest and pruning seasons. The Swan Valley's proximity to Perth makes it an accessible location for those seeking horticultural work without being too far from urban amenities. Expect a Mediterranean climate with hot, dry summers, necessitating a strong focus on irrigation management and pest control for the local crops.
